Secondary School Teachers, Except Special and Career/Technical Education Salary in Utah

BLS OEWS May 2025 • 7 metro areas • Utah

Secondary School Teachers, Except Special and Career/Technical Education in Utah earn a median salary of $71,900 per year on average across 7 metro and nonmetro areas, +11.3% vs the national median of $64,580. An estimated 11,460 secondary school teachers, except special and career/technical education are employed across Utah, with salaries ranging from $62,360 to $76,580 depending on location.

      Secondary School Teachers, Except Special and Career/Technical Education salaries by city in Utah

      Metro area Median salary 25th pct 75th pct Employed
      Salt Lake City, UT $76,580 $61,310 $84,150 4,420
      Wasatch Front Fringe Utah $75,960 $58,670 $80,120 450
      High Desert Utah $75,640 $57,870 $90,510 960
      St. George, UT $74,740 $58,020 $76,250 450
      Logan, UT-ID $71,650 $56,320 $79,630 940
      Provo, UT $66,370 $55,920 $76,990 2,750
      Ogden, UT $62,360 $57,380 $77,980 1,490
